Position

This is an opportunity to kickstart your career by joining Canonical. If you have a passion for technology and Linux, and an eagerness to learn, you will enjoy working with some of the best people in the industry. As a Linux Desktop Support Associate, you will be accountable for delivering technical support to employees and customers, as well as facilitating AV support for office conferences and events.

In this role, you will own and manage your support cases, providing technical expertise and excellent communication as a service-oriented professional. You will be the main technical resource for the office, prioritizing customer issues, and balancing in-person support with remote case management. You will also have the opportunity to learn about new products and technologies and participate in various training sessions and company events.

About Canonical:
Canonical is a pioneering tech firm at the forefront of the global move to open source. As the publisher of Ubuntu, we are committed to changing the world through innovation and excellence. We are proud to be a remote-first company and foster a workplace free from discrimination.
